No biofilter for me. Just doing an 80% water exchange every week. My water is stellar and doesn't need any treatment. But last year I still had significant fungus problems after the fish had been in cold water for 15 weeks.


Yikes that would scare me!

So you don't see ammonia creep up before you do your water change?

What kind of fish load do you have?





I forgot to mention one extremely important point. I am feeding my fish next to nothing. Maybe 2% of what they'd get in the summer. Just enough to keep them from starving. Of course that could also be leading to some of the fungus problems. I need to feed them enough to keep them from getting sick...but no more.
